依赖
关于maven依赖死活都下载不了终极解决方案
关于maven依赖死活都下载不了终极解决⽅案项⽬想下载⼀个依赖,在idea中死都下不了,查看⽹上各种解决⽅案都没有效果,出绝招,我使⽤命令下载jar然后导⼊到项⽬引⽤的maven 仓库类似这种命令:mvn install:install-file -Dfile=d:\setup\dubbo-2.8.4.jar -DgroupId=com.alibaba -DartifactId=dubbo -Dv...
使用Maven命令行下载依赖库
使⽤Maven命令⾏下载依赖库这篇⽂章,不是教⼤家如何新建maven项⽬,不是与⼤家分享Eclipse与Maven整合。注意:是在命令⾏下使⽤Maven下载依赖库。废话不说,步骤如下:1、保证电脑上已成功安装了JDK。运⾏java -version看看是否可以显⽰,如果未成功安装,请查阅相关教程。配置完成后,请看mvn -version,如果成功,可以看到mvn的版本信息。有些操作系统修改环境变量...
前端项目的依赖管理
前端项目的依赖管理在当今的互联网时代,前端开发已经成为了非常重要的一项技术。随着互联网应用的增多和前端技术的不断发展,前端项目的复杂性也随之增加。在开发前端项目的过程中,依赖管理是一个非常重要的环节。因此,本文将从几个方面阐述前端项目的依赖管理。一、什么是前端项目的依赖管理是指在开发前端项目时,使用和管理各种前端工具和库的过程。在前端开发中,我们通常会使用诸如HTML、CSS和JavaScript...
Java将字符串转换成可执行代码
Java将字符串转换成可执⾏代码1. 添加依赖<dependency><groupId>org.apachemons</groupId><artifactId>commons-jexl3</artifactId><version>3.1</version></dependency>2. 封装⽅法...
idea mavenhelper maven路径
idea mavenhelper maven路径在Java开发中,Maven是一种广泛使用的项目管理工具,而IntelliJ IDEA是一款强大的Java集成开发环境。为了更便捷地使用Maven构建和管理项目,Idea Maven Helper插件应运而生。本文将深入探讨Idea Maven Helper插件的作用、使用方法以及Maven路径配置等相关知识点。一、Idea Maven Helper...
SpringIoC的应用场景
SpringIoC的应⽤场景1. 在 Java EE企业应⽤开发中,前⾯介绍的IoC(控制反转)设计模式,是解耦组件之间复杂关系的利器,Spring IoC模块就是这个模式的⼀种实现。javabean是干嘛的2. 在EJB模式中,应⽤开发⼈员需要编写EJB组件,⽽这种组件需要满⾜EJB容器的规范,才能运⾏在EJB容器中,从⽽获取事务管理、⽣命周期管理这些组件开发的基本服务。3. 从获取的基本服务上...
beancopier用法
beancopier用法`BeanCopier` 是一个 Java 类库,用于方便地进行 JavaBean 之间的属性拷贝。它能够提高属性拷贝的性能,避免手动编写大量的属性赋值代码。`BeanCopier` 是 Apache Commons BeanUtils 库的一个组件,但也有其他的 JavaBean 拷贝工具。以下是 `BeanCopier` 的基本用法:1. 引入依赖: 如果你使用 Mav...
MySQL5.7.5及以上groupby分组报错问题
MySQL5.7.5及以上groupby分组报错问题MySQL 5.7.5及以上 group by 报错问题问题出现的原因:MySQL 5.7.5及以上功能依赖检测功能。如果启⽤了ONLY_FULL_GROUP_BY (仅限于) SQL模式(默认情况下),MySQL将拒绝选择列表,HAVING条件或ORDER BY列表的查询引⽤在GROUP BY⼦句中既未命名的⾮集合列,也不在功能上依赖于它们。(...
golang在windows中设置环境变量的操作
golang在windows中设置环境变量的操作安装完成后需要在系统环境变量中设置GOPATH为项⽬⽬录GOROOT为安装⽬录path中设置好安装⽬录到bin⽬录打开cmd,输⼊go env,出现如下配置⽣效补充:Golang 环境变量须知1.前⾔⽆论你是使⽤ Windows、Linux 还是 Mac 操作系统来开发 Go 应⽤程序,在安装好 Go 安装语⾔开发⼯具之后,都必须配置好 Go 语⾔开...
VsCode搭建Go语言开发环境的配置教程
VsCode搭建Go语⾔开发环境的配置教程现在Go1.14都已经发布好些⽇⼦了,之前发的Go环境搭建教程早已过时,只是因为时间问题⼀直没来得及更新这次怀着愧疚的⼼情,在凌晨四点时,将这教程进⾏⼀个更新注意:本教程最⼤的好处是不需要梯⼦。 直接在墙内可进⾏⼀切操作,⽂章写给纯⼩⽩的,部分Linux常识解释的过多,熟悉的⼈请略过Go的安装安装基本还是之前的⽼样⼦,不过现在的安装早已省事不少,不再需要配...
MacGolang开发环境配置
MacGolang开发环境配置Mac Golang 开发环境配置go语言安装教程Golang 介绍Go(⼜称Golang)是Google开发的⼀种静态强类型、编译型、并发型,并具有垃圾回收功能的编程语⾔。由罗伯特·格瑞史莫,罗勃·派克(Rob Pike)及肯·汤普逊于2007年9⽉开始设计Go,稍后Ian Lance Taylor、Russ Cox加⼊项⽬。Go是基于Inferno操作系统所开发的...
beego-admin通用后台系统
beego-admin通⽤后台系统beego-admin 通⽤后台系统beego-admin v1.0版本,基于beego框架和AdminLte前端框架,开发的go语⾔通⽤后台系统,在beego框架的基础上,封装了后台系统的分页功能,excel数据导出功能等丰富常⽤的扩展,基于MVC模式,html界⾯随⼼定义,相较于某些后台复杂代码⽣成的前端html元素,使⽤原⽣的html原⽣作为前端显⽰,更加的...
马哥GO运维开发架构项目实战学习笔记-2020
马哥GO运维开发架构项⽬实战学习笔记-2020Go语⾔作为后起之秀,在语⾔层⾯具有语法简洁、执⾏效率⾼的特点;相⽐之下,Java和Python、PHP都显得低效,C++则太过⿇烦,⽽Go则可以做到简单与⾼效兼顾。go和java后端开发劣势Go语⾔是主打并发、为并发⽽⽣的,其出发点即是瞄准⼤数据+云计算时代背景下的⾼并发、分布式应⽤场景。可以在不同平台直接编译⽣成可执⾏程序,基础内存占⽤很少,⼩应⽤...
数据库规范化理论
数据库规范化理论数据库规范化理论是关系数据库设计中重要的理论基础之一。它旨在通过分解关系数据库的表,消除冗余数据以及确保数据一致性和完整性,从而提高数据库的性能和可维护性。数据库规范化理论的基本概念包括函数依赖、正则化和范式等。函数依赖是数据库中的一个关键概念,它描述了一个属性对于另一个属性的依赖关系。如果一个属性的值取决于另一个属性的值,我们说这两个属性之间存在函数依赖关系。函数依赖又可以分为完...
数据库基础与应用课后练习题_复习资料
第一章一、判断题1.实体之间的联系有三种,既1对1、1对多和多对多。(√)2.在一个关系数据模型中,所有关系的定义也用一个关系来表示,称为其元关系或数据字典(√)3.在关系数据模型中,运算对象是关系,而运算结果是一个值。(×)4.数据库体系结构具有三级模式结构和两级存储映象。(√)5.进行数据库系统运行和管理的人员称作应用程序员。(×)二、选择题1.数据库管理系统对数据所具有的控制功能不包括(D)...
数据库:候选码、主码、超码、外码、主属性、非主属性
数据库:候选码、主码、超码、外码、主属性、⾮主属性⼀:相关定义及举例定义在《数据库系统概论》(第五版)——王珊、萨师煊编著中:1.候选码的定义:如果关系中的某⼀属性组的值能唯⼀地标识⼀个元组,则称该属性组为候选码;2.主码的定义:如果⼀个关系有多个候选码,则选定其中⼀个为主码;3.主属性定义:候选码的诸属性称为主属性;4.⾮主属性定义:不包含在任何候选码中的属性称为⾮主属性;5.实体完整性规则:如...
数据库-常见概念及一二三、BC范式
数据库-常见概念及⼀⼆三、BC范式属性闭包闭包就是由⼀个属性直接或间接推导出的所有属性的集合。闭包算法:result = a //求属性a的属性闭包while(result 发⽣改变){for 每⼀个result中的关系a->bif(a 在result中){result加⼊属性b}}测试超键:如果a是R的超键那么我们可以计算a的闭包A,如果A包含了R的所有属性那么a的确是R的超键...
数据库原理知识点总结
数据库系统概述一、有关概念1.数据2.数据库DB3.数据库管理系统DBMSAccess桌面DBMS VFPSQL ServerOracle客户机/服务器型DBMS MySQLDB24.数据库系统DBS数据库DB数据库管理系统DBMS开发工具应用系统二、数据管理技术的发展1.数据管理的三个阶段1人工管理阶段2文件系统阶段3数据库系统阶段概念模型一、模型的三个世界...
...主码(主键)、主属性、非主属性、关系数据库中的依赖、关系数据库范...
超码、候选码、主码(主键)、主属性、⾮主属性、关系数据库中的依赖、关系数据库范式、反范式超码:可以区分记录的⼀个属性或多个属性的集合。候选码:超码的最⼩集,即包含最少属性的超码。超码的最⼩集可以有多个,即多个集合⼤⼩相同,但元素构成不完全相同的最⼩集。主码(主键):被选中的⼀个候选码。候选码可以有多个,主码只有⼀个。主键如果是由多个属性构成,⼜称联合主键。主属性:属于某个候选码的属性。⾮主属性:不...
javasdk设计原则_java设计模式遵循的六大原则
javasdk设计原则_java设计模式遵循的六⼤原则问题由来:在软件的⽣命周期内,因为变化、升级和维护等原因需要对软件原有代码进⾏修改时,可能会给旧代码中引⼊错误,也可能会使我们不得不对整个功能进⾏重构,并且需要原有代码经过重新测试。解决⽅案:当软件需要变化时,尽量通过扩展软件实体的⾏为来实现变化,⽽不是通过修改已有的代码来实现变化。1.单⼀职责原则2.⾥⽒替换原则3.依赖倒置原则4.接⼝隔离原...
core入门1:linux上安装coresdk2.2(离线安装和yum仓库安装)_百...
core⼊门1:linux上安装coresdk2.2(离线安装和yum仓库安装)实验环境:操作系统:最⼩化安装的centos7.6 x64sdk:dotnet-sdk-2.2.401-linux-x64-binarie说明:linux上安装dotnetcore sdk有两种⽅式,⼀个是使⽤编译好的离线安装包,⼀个是使⽤微软提供的yum仓库。⼀、使⽤离线sdk安装包安装sdk1.1...
移动应用开发中的第三方SDK集成技巧
移动应用开发中的第三方SDK集成技巧随着智能手机的普及,移动应用开发变得异常繁重。开发人员不再仅仅关注应用的功能设计和用户体验,还需要考虑诸如广告、社交分享、数据统计等功能的集成。而第三方SDK(软件开发工具包)的出现为开发人员提供了便利,能够快速集成各种功能,并且解决开发过程中的一些痛点。第一,选择适合的第三方SDK在集成第三方SDK之前,开发人员需要充分了解并选择适合自己应用的SDK。优秀的第...
androidsdk官方文档,AndroidSDK使用指南
androidsdk官⽅⽂档,AndroidSDK使⽤指南Bugly Android SDK 使⽤指南库⽂件导⼊Bugly⽀持⾃动集成和⼿动集成两种⽅式,如果您使⽤Gradle编译Apk,我们强烈推荐您使⽤⾃动接⼊⽅式配置库⽂件。⾃动集成(推荐)Bugly⽀持JCenter仓库和Maven Central仓库。为了实现更加灵活的配置,Bugly SDK(2.1.5及以上版本)和NDK(SO库)⽬前...
从“路径依赖”看,为什么“强者恒强,弱者更弱”
从“路径依赖”看,为什么“强者恒强,弱者更弱”文/麦穗小鱼题记:你知道,为什么两条铁轨之间的标准距离是4英尺8.5英寸吗?你知道,为什么美国航天飞机火箭助推器的宽度参考的是两匹马屁股之间的宽度吗?你知道,为什么“Q,W,A,S”这几个键会被放在电脑键盘的左上角吗?你知道,为什么人们常说“女怕嫁错郎,男怕入错行”吗?你知道,为什么很多人“撞了南墙也不回头,到了黄河也不死心”吗?......这所有的一...
Gradle用户使用指南
Gradle⽤户使⽤指南0. 前⾔完全由个⼈翻译,能⼒有限,有些细节地⽅翻译不是很通顺,⼤家可以参考英⽂版本阅读,如果有问题,欢迎指正。转载请事先沟通,未经允许,谢绝转载。1. 新⼯具介绍(Introduction)能够复⽤代码和资源能够构建⼏种不同版本参数的应⽤能够配置、扩展、⾃定义构建过程1.1 为什么选择Gradle(Why Gradle?)Gradle是⼀款具有优势的构建⼯具,通过插件可以...
Android应用配置文件解析
Android应⽤配置⽂件解析应⽤配置⽂件解析l配置⽂件扮演翻译官的⾓⾊,将应⽤所包含的的组件、各组件的能⼒和配置以及应⽤环境介绍给Android框架层的各个服务,让Android知道如何去调度各个组件。l权限配置:权限配置是Android安全体系的部分。在配置⽂件中,应⽤科定义第三⽅访问其中的组件和资源所需要的权限。应⽤也可...
AndroidStudio统一依赖管理Composingbuilds
AndroidStudio统⼀依赖管理ComposingbuildsAndroid Studio统⼀依赖管理背景在我们的AS项⽬中,经常引⽤多个Module,多⼈参与项⽬开发,这种背景下,我们会时常遇到版本冲突问题,出现不同的compileSdkVersion等,导致我们的包体变⼤,项⽬运⾏时间变长,所以将依赖版本统⼀是⼀个项⽬优化的必经之路。你可能遇到这样的问题在架构设计阶段,你的依赖库是这样的...
Android使用gradle依赖管理、依赖冲突终极解决方案
Android使⽤gradle依赖管理、依赖冲突终极解决⽅案Android使⽤gradle依赖管理、依赖冲突终极解决⽅案在Android开发中,相信遇到关于版本依赖的问题的同学有不少。虽然Android Studio⼀般都会⾃动帮我们去重,但是有时候去重失败了还是需要⼿动处理。在这⾥总结下⾃⼰长期遇到的各类问题的解决⽅式。统⼀版本管理当我们的项⽬有多个module的时候,各⾃都可以在⾃⼰的buil...
uni-app小程序SDK接入
uni-app⼩程序SDK接⼊uni-app接⼊记录。androidstudio集成⽂档:注意事项:1. targetSDK 最⾼28最优26 设置值域超过28可能在android10以上⼿机出现⽩屏问题。2. miniSDK 须为19及以上(在官⽅的demo中这样说的)3. ndk仅⽀持:‘x86’,‘armeabi-v7a’,“arm64-v8a” 不⽀持armeabi4. 若uni⼩程序集成...
如何在Android应用中集成第三方库和SDK(一)
在现如今的移动应用开发领域,集成第三方库和SDK已经成为一项常见且必备的技术。Android作为全球最大的移动操作系统之一,也有着丰富的第三方库和SDK可供使用。本文将讨论如何在Android应用中高效地集成第三方库和SDK,以提升应用的功能和用户体验。### 理解第三方库和SDK首先,需要明确第三方库和SDK的概念。第三方库是由其他开发者编写的可复用代码模块,通过引入这些库,我们可以快速地集成一...